feat: add networkd subsystem and fix code review issues

Phase 1-4: Networkd subsystem
- lib/network.py: systemd-networkd config renderer (.network INI files)
  with full schema support: [Match], [Link], [Network], [Address], [Route],
  [DHCPv4], [DHCPv6] sections. One Address/=DNS= line per value per spec.
  Route sections use #N suffix per systemd.syntax(7).
- lib/network.py: generate_network_files() with 50-<name>.network prefix
  and stale file cleanup
- lib/network.py: collect_upstream_dns() filters local/private DNS
- lib/network.py: infer_dhcp_ranges() and infer_zones() helpers
- daemon/handlers/network.py: routes for GET/POST /network/interfaces
  and full apply with DNS upstream sync to dnsmasq
- webui/api/network.py: Flask blueprint for /api/network/* endpoints
- webui/api: interfaces page updated with IP config inline editing
- lib/state.py: networkd collector using parse_networkctl_status()
- system/sudoers.d/vacuum-walld: networkctl + systemd-network rules
- system/systemd/vacuum-walld.service: ReadWritePaths for /etc/systemd/network
- install.sh: ACME email now optional, configured from WebUI
- lib/acme.py: get_email() falls back to declarative config

Phase 5: Code review fixes
- daemon/server.py: path params now win over JSON body and query params
  in request body merge (prevents config save name override)
- daemon/server.py: remove dead 'import re'
- daemon/handlers/network.py: replace Path.mkdir() with sudo mkdir
  for /etc/systemd/network (ProtectSystem=strict compatibility)
- system/sudoers.d/vacuum-walld: pin systemctl to specific commands
  (reload/is-active dnsmasq instead of wildcard)
- system/sudoers.d/vacuum-walld: restore !requiretty and section comment
- lib/network.py: remove unused _MANAGEMENT_PORTS constant
- webui/api/network.py: remove redundant body[\name\] = name in save_interface

Tests: 332 passing (110 new/updated), ruff clean
